Breaking: Federal Labour Minister Seamus O’Regan says B.C. port workers strike 'illegal'

VANCOUVER—Federal Labour Minister Seamus O’Regan declared Wednesday that the surprise return of a port workers’ strike in B.C.’s biggest city is “illegal,” as the government won’t rule out using back-to-work legislation to end the disruptive labour dispute.

The vast majority of ports in the province ground to a halt for 13 days earlier this month after the union, which represents 7,400 workers at more than 30 terminals around the province, began a strike after negotiations hit an impasse.Sticking points in the labour dispute with the BC Maritime Employers Association were wages, automation and contracting out work. The association released a statement slamming the union leadership for rejecting the deal.
